首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从异步函数调用同步函数

是一种将异步操作转换为同步操作的技术。在异步编程中,异步函数是指会立即返回,不会阻塞程序执行的函数,而同步函数则会阻塞程序执行直到函数完成。下面是完善且全面的答案:

异步函数调用同步函数的方法是使用回调函数或者Promise。当一个异步函数需要调用一个同步函数时,可以将同步函数作为回调函数传递给异步函数,或者使用Promise对象封装同步函数,然后在异步函数中调用它。这样,在异步函数中可以等待同步函数执行完毕并获取其返回结果。

在前端开发中,异步函数调用同步函数常用于处理需要同步执行的操作,例如在获取数据后进行数据处理或页面渲染。在后端开发中,异步函数调用同步函数常用于处理复杂的业务逻辑,例如在处理请求时需要根据同步函数的返回结果进行判断或处理。

在软件测试中,异步函数调用同步函数可以用于确保测试用例的正确执行顺序,避免并发执行导致的测试结果不确定性。

在数据库操作中,异步函数调用同步函数可以用于确保数据库操作的顺序和一致性,例如在插入数据后立即查询数据并进行后续操作。

在服务器运维中,异步函数调用同步函数可以用于处理需要同步执行的系统配置和资源管理操作,例如在启动服务器后进行初始化配置。

在云原生应用开发中,异步函数调用同步函数可以用于处理异步消息和事件,例如在消息队列中消费消息时需要调用同步函数进行业务处理。

在网络通信中,异步函数调用同步函数可以用于处理同步的网络请求和响应,例如在发送请求后等待响应并进行下一步操作。

在网络安全中,异步函数调用同步函数可以用于处理同步的加密和解密操作,例如在加密数据后进行解密并进行后续处理。

在音视频处理中,异步函数调用同步函数可以用于处理同步的音视频编解码和处理操作,例如在解码音频后进行后续的音频处理。

在多媒体处理中,异步函数调用同步函数可以用于处理同步的图片、视频等多媒体文件的处理操作,例如在处理图片时需要调用同步函数进行图像处理。

在人工智能应用开发中,异步函数调用同步函数可以用于处理同步的模型训练和推理操作,例如在模型训练后进行推理并进行后续处理。

在物联网应用中,异步函数调用同步函数可以用于处理同步的设备数据采集和控制操作,例如在设备采集数据后进行数据处理和设备控制。

在移动应用开发中,异步函数调用同步函数可以用于处理同步的用户交互和数据操作,例如在用户输入后进行数据处理和更新UI。

在存储领域,异步函数调用同步函数可以用于处理同步的文件读写和数据操作,例如在读取文件后进行数据处理和写入文件。

在区块链应用中,异步函数调用同步函数可以用于处理同步的交易和合约执行操作,例如在交易确认后进行合约执行和状态更新。

在元宇宙应用中,异步函数调用同步函数可以用于处理同步的虚拟世界交互和数据操作,例如在虚拟世界中进行用户交互和数据处理。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共80个视频
2024年go语言初级1
福大大架构师每日一题
这个初级Go语言视频课程将带你逐步学习和掌握Go语言的基础知识。从语言的特点和用途入手,课程将涵盖基本语法、变量和数据类型、流程控制、函数、包管理等关键概念。通过实际示例和练习,你将学会如何使用Go语言构建简单的程序。无论你是初学者还是已有其它编程语言基础,该视频课程将为你打下扎实的Go编程基础,帮助你进一步探索和开发个人项目。
共11个视频
2024年go语言初级2
福大大架构师每日一题
这个初级Go语言视频课程将带你逐步学习和掌握Go语言的基础知识。从语言的特点和用途入手,课程将涵盖基本语法、变量和数据类型、流程控制、函数、包管理等关键概念。通过实际示例和练习,你将学会如何使用Go语言构建简单的程序。无论你是初学者还是已有其它编程语言基础,该视频课程将为你打下扎实的Go编程基础,帮助你进一步探索和开发个人项目。
领券